034-5042 Technical Specifications
ParameterValue
Mounting typeFree Hanging (In-Line)
Connector typePlug, Male Pin
Fastening typeBayonet Lock
Frequency - max6 GHz
Cable groupRG-55, 142, 223, 400
Operating temperature-65°C~165°C
Body materialBrass
Housing colorSilver
Dielectric materialPolyt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E)
Center contact materialPhosphor Bronze
PackageBulk
Includes3 pcs - 1 Connector, 1 Contact, 1 Ferrule
Impedance50Ohm
Body finishNickel
Mating cycles500
Number of ports1
Shield terminationCrimp
Contact terminationCrimp
Center contact platingGold

Product details

The 034-5042: It handles signals up to 6 GHz — well past the standard BNC's 4 GHz ceiling — making it a fit for test equipment, broadcast video, and instrumentation where bandwidth headroom matters. The contact termination is crimp, and the shield is also crimped — no solder, no heat gun, just a standard hex crimp tool for the cable jacket and braid. The included ferrule compresses over the braid for a gas-tight shield termination that holds up to 500 mating cycles.

Cable group covers RG-55, RG-223, and RG-400 — all 50 Ohm coax. The silver housing color is the bare nickel finish — no paint to chip or flake in high-vibration environments.
